About Alanya

Alanya is a picturesque coastal city in southern Turkey, renowned for its stunning beaches, historic landmarks, and vibrant nightlife. Nestled between the Mediterranean Sea and the Taurus Mountains, it offers a perfect blend of natural beauty and rich cultural heritage.

Top Attractions

Alanya Castle

A medieval fortress dating back to the Seljuk era, offering panoramic views of the city and the Mediterranean Sea.

Historical 2-3 hours Free (castle grounds), 10 TL (museum)

Cleopatra Beach

A beautiful sandy beach with crystal-clear waters, named after the legend that Cleopatra and Mark Antony visited it.

Beach Half day Free (public access), sunbeds and umbrellas for rent

Dim Cave

A stunning cave system with stalactites and stalagmites, located in the Taurus Mountains.

Nature 1-2 hours 15 TL

Day trips

Side
65 km (40 miles) • Full day

An ancient Greek and Roman city with well-preserved ruins, including a temple, theater, and agora.

Aspendos
100 km (62 miles) • Full day

Famous for its incredibly well-preserved Roman theater, one of the best in the world.
